The distal marginal ridge of the first premolar is adjacent to the buccal cusp ridge and is interrupted by grooves.

Answer the following statement true (T) or false (F)


False

The distal marginal ridge of the first premolar is perpendicular to the buccal cusp ridge, and there is no interruption by grooves.
